包括App的功能需求、设计复杂度、技术难度、开发团队的经验和技术水平等。以下是对这些因素进行分点归纳和详细说明:
一、功能需求
简单App:如果App的功能较为简单,如仅包含信息展示、联系方式等基本功能,开发周期可能相对较短,大约在1到3个月之间。
中等复杂度App:这类App可能需要一些定制功能、用户交互、数据库集成等,开发周期可能会延长至3到6个月。
复杂App:具有复杂功能、用户体验、后台管理等要求的App,开发周期可能超过6个月,甚至需要1年或更长时间。
二、设计复杂度
UI/UX设计是App开发过程中的重要环节,其复杂度直接影响开发周期。简单的设计可能只需1-2周,而复杂的设计可能需要1-3个月甚至更长时间。
原型设计、界面交互设计、视觉设计等多个方面都需要投入大量时间和精力。
三、技术难度
技术难度是影响开发周期的另一个关键因素。如果App需要使用到新兴技术或复杂的算法,开发团队可能需要更多的时间来学习和实践。
此外,跨平台开发(如同时支持iOS和Android)也会增加技术难度和开发周期。
四、开发团队
开发团队的经验和技术水平对开发周期有着重要影响。经验丰富的团队能够更快速地理解需求、设计架构并实现功能。
团队规模也是一个重要因素。规模较大的团队可以并行处理多个任务,从而缩短开发周期。但是,这也需要有效的项目管理和团队协作来确保项目顺利进行。
五、其他因素
需求分析、测试与调试、发布与后期维护等阶段也需要一定的时间投入。
如果采用快速开发工具或模板进行开发,可以在一定程度上缩短开发周期。但是,这种方法可能无法满足高度定制化的需求。
鞍山科派企业网站定制、鞍山做网站,公司专业定制网站建设、模板网站建设、手机网站、微信小程序定制、智能建站、
微信小程制作、鞍山网络公司。